为什么选 Thinkpad?

FreeBSD 似乎比较青睐 Thinkpad, 提供了很多驱动和应用,例如 tpb 等。另外,在 /boot/loader.conf 里加入

acpi_video_load="YES"
acpi_ibm_load="YES"

就可以加载 acpi 支持。众所周知,FreeBSD 对 acpi 的支持一直是其诟病。可见 FreeBSD 对 Thinkpad 的“爱护”。当然,其他品牌的笔记本电脑,FreeBSD 也是相当支持的(我不是 Lenovo 的托儿)。我看 freebsd 对笔记本电脑的支持列表 http://laptop.bsdgroup.de/freebsd/,其中 Thinkpads 较多。而 FreeBSD 对 T42 的支持是 100%(不过休眠待机功能不work。。。)。所以,网上有人问买什么笔记本装 FreeBSD 最合适,一般的回答是 old Thinkpads of T, X, R series.

/boot/loader.conf 配置

有些硬件的驱动没有写入内核文件,而是通过模块引导,像无线网卡、蓝牙、SD卡等。X61的无线网卡是iwn,X200的无线网卡是ath,用户根据机器的具体情况改写下面的 /boot/loader.conf 配置。

#boot_verbose="-v"        # provide more dmesg information
autoboot_delay="1"        # Set wait time to 1 second
loader_logo="beastie"     # The color logo of FreeBSD
cuse4bsd_load="YES"

############################
## Load necessary modules ##
############################
cpuctl_load="YES"         # CPU Throttling 
coretemp_load="YES"       # Thermal Monitoring
#linprocfs_load="YES"      # Linux proc
#linsysfs_load="YES"       # Linux sysfs
acpi_ibm_load="YES"       # acpi for IBM ThinkPad
acpi_video_load="YES"     # ACPI Video Extensions driver
snd_hda_load="YES"        # sound card, comment out if in kernel
speaker_load="YES"        # console speaker device driver

#####################
### Bluetooth USB ###
#####################
#ubtbcmfw_load="YES       # Firmware loader for Broadcom Bluetooth 
#ng_ubt_load="YES"        # Bluetooth driver

################
### Wireless ###
################
wlan_scan_ap_load="YES"   # Wireless 
wlan_scan_sta_load="YES"  # Wireless 
if_ath_load="YES"         # Internal LAN module
if_ath_pci_load="YES"     # For Thinkpad X61
wlan_wep_load="YES"
wlan_ccmp_load="YES"
wlan_tkip_load="YES"

####################
## SD card reader ##
####################
#sdhci_load="YES"
#mmcsd_load="YES"
#mmc_load="YES"

##########################
### End of loader.conf ###
##########################

有关声卡的一点小注记

在 /boot/device.hints 里添加

# snd_hda
hint.pcm.0.vol="85"
hint.hdac.0.cad0.nid26.config="as=1"
hint.hdac.0.cad0.nid22.config="as=1 seq=15"
hint.hdac.0.cad0.nid29.config="as=2"
hint.hdac.0.cad0.nid24.config="as=3"
